Summary

  • $2.1 trillion in planned spending by Samsung, SK Hynix and Micron has shifted investor focus from AI-driven shortages to the risk of a memory-chip glut, knocking Samsung, SK Hynix and Micron shares down more than 30% from recent highs.
  • SK Hynix has pledged to double capacity within five years, while Samsung and SK Hynix together aim to double South Korea's DRam output, a buildout that could tip conventional DRam into oversupply by 2028 or 2029 if AI demand weakens.
  • AI demand itself is under scrutiny as investors question whether hyperscalers can sustain heavy spending; reports that Meta may sell excess computing capacity have added to concerns that the first infrastructure wave could fade.
  • New supply will take years to arrive and HBM remains tighter because it is harder to make, but China is the key swing factor: CXMT could reach 500,000 wafers a month by end-2028, with China seen driving about 30% of net DRam additions through 2028.

Navigating the $2 Trillion AI Memory Surge: 2026-2028 Boom, Oversupply Warning, and Long-Term Industry Impact

Overview

As of July 2026, the memory chip industry is booming due to the soaring demands of artificial intelligence infrastructure. This surge is not just a typical cycle but marks a major shift in the market, driven by the huge computational needs of AI, especially for training large language models and running complex applications. As a result, there is an insatiable demand for high-performance memory, leading to significant profit gains for major companies and creating supply constraints across the sector. Industry leaders project massive growth, with the AI chip market expected to exceed $500 billion by 2028 and the broader data center chip market reaching $1 trillion.
